We've encountered a bizarre problem attempting to ftp from a virtual box where typing the username issues a double carriage return even though a single one is pressed. Consequently the receiving ftp server treats the second carriage return as a null password and therefore causes the login to fail. The problem does not occur on the physical box, only the virtual machines

The command line workaround is to type user username password from within the ftp session i.e username and pass on the same line.

Unfortunately what led us to use ftp and not scp is that the vz server needs to run a closed source java program which ftps out and is also hitting the double carriage return / login failed problem

I realise this is pretty obscure but if anyone has any ideas it would be appreciated

Hi, I doubt it is a problem caused by openvz. Can you run a strace on the ftp client and see the extra linebreak being generated by the user app? same version of the ftp client in the VE vs out?
